Given:
The graph of system of inequalities.
To find:
The system of inequalities.
Solution:
From the given graph it is clear that the shaded region is lies below the line y=10 and the boundary line y=10 is a solid line. So, the sign of inequality must be \(\leq\).
\(y\leq 10\).
The shaded region lies on the right side of the y-axis. So, \(x\geq 0\).
Another boundary line passes through the point (0,1) and (1,2). So, the equation of the line is:
\(y-y_1=\dfrac{y_2-y_1}{x_2-x_1}(x-x_1)\)
\(y-1=\dfrac{2-1}{1-0}(x-0)\)
\(y=1(x)+1\)
\(y=x+1\)
The boundary line \(y=x+1\) is a dotted line and the shaded region lies above the boundary line, so the sign of inequality must be \(>\).
\(y> x+1\)
So, the required system of inequalities is:
\(y> x+1\)
\(y\leq 10\)
\(x\geq 0\)
Therefore, the correct option is B.

water runs into a soncial tankat the rate of 9 ft cu per min. the tank stands vertext down and has a height of 10 feet and a base raduis if 5 feet. how fast
When the water is 6 feet deep, then the water level rise at the rate of 0.22 feet per minute
Water runs into a conical tank at the rate of 9 ft^3 per min
The rate of change volume with respect to time dV / dt = 9 ft^3 per min
The height of the tank = 10 feet
The base radius of the tank = 5 feet
The volume of the cone = (1/3)πr^2h
The water is 6 feet deep
r/h = 6/10
r/h = 3/5
r = 3/5h
Substitute the values in the equation
The volume of the cone = (1/3) π(3/5h)^2 ×h
= (3/25)πh^3
Differentiate the equation
dV/ dt = (9/25)πh^2 × dh/dt
9 = (9/25)πh^2 × dh/dt
dh/dt = 9 / ((9/25)π×6^2
= 0.22 feet per min
Therefore, the water level is rising at the rate of 0.22 feet per minute

A particle is moved along the x-axis by a force that measures F(x) = 2x Newtons at each point x meters from the point x = 0. Find the work done (in Newton-meters) when the particle is moved from x = 0 to 2 =2 meters. Give a whole number answer, with no units.
Expert Answer
To find the work done when moving the particle along the x-axis, we can use the formula for work, which is the integral of the force function F(x) with respect to x over the given interval. In this case, the force function is F(x) = 2x, and the interval is from x = 0 to x = 2 meters.
So, the work done can be calculated as:
Work = ∫(F(x) dx) from 0 to 2 = ∫(2x dx) from 0 to 2
To find the integral of 2x, we can use the power rule:
∫(2x dx) = x^2 + C
Now, we can evaluate the integral over the interval [0, 2]:
Work = (2^2 - 0^2) = 4 - 0 = 4
Therefore, the work done when the particle is moved from x = 0 to x = 2 meters is 4 Newton-meters. As a whole number answer without units, the answer is 4.

How many 4-digit numbers are multiples of at least one of these two numbers: 2 and 5
(I only need answer)
Answer:
To determine the number of 4-digit numbers that are multiples of at least one of the numbers 2 and 5, we can use the principle of inclusion-exclusion.
First, let's find the number of 4-digit numbers that are multiples of 2. The first 4-digit multiple of 2 is 1000, and the last 4-digit multiple of 2 is 9998. To find the count of multiples, we can divide the difference between these two numbers by 2 and add 1 (since we're including both endpoints):
Number of multiples of 2 = (9998 - 1000) / 2 + 1 = 4500
Next, let's find the number of 4-digit numbers that are multiples of 5. The first 4-digit multiple of 5 is 1000, and the last 4-digit multiple of 5 is 9995. Similar to before, we divide the difference between these two numbers by 5 and add 1:
Number of multiples of 5 = (9995 - 1000) / 5 + 1 = 1800
However, if we simply add these two counts together, we will be counting the multiples of 10 twice (since 10 is a multiple of both 2 and 5). To correct this, we need to subtract the number of 4-digit multiples of 10.
To find the number of 4-digit multiples of 10, we divide the difference between the first and last 4-digit multiples of 10 (1000 and 9990) by 10 and add 1:
Number of multiples of 10 = (9990 - 1000) / 10 + 1 = 900
Now we can use the principle of inclusion-exclusion to calculate the final count:
Number of 4-digit numbers that are multiples of at least one of 2 or 5 = Number of multiples of 2 + Number of multiples of 5 - Number of multiples of 10
= 4500 + 1800 - 900 = 5400
Therefore, there are 5400 4-digit numbers that are multiples of at least one of the numbers 2 and 5.
